Terblend N NG-02EF

The product line Terblend® N, comprising blends of ABS with PA 6, provides very good mechanical properties, a high melt flow, and very good chemical resistance provided by the polyamide component. Parts from Terblend® have acoustic dampening properties and show in unpainted, textured surfaces a nice matt appearance. Terblend® N NG-02EF is a low emission 8% glass fiber reinforced “Enhanced Flow” grade, containing also a powerful UV package. The reinforcement provides a higher heat performance and is invisible in combination with most automotive surface textures.

    Properties of Terblend N NG-02EF

    Property, Test Condition Standard Unit Values
    Rheological Properties
    Melt Volume Rate, 240 °C/10 kg ISO 1133 cm³/10 min 40
    Mechanical Properties
    Charpy Notched Impact Strength, 23° C ISO 179/1eA kJ/m² 11
    Charpy Notched Impact Strength, -30 °C ISO 179/1eA kJ/m² 6
    Charpy Unnotched, 23 °C ISO 179/1eU kJ/m² 30
    Charpy Unnotched, -30 °C ISO 179/1eU kJ/m² 35
    Izod Notched Impact Strength, 23 °C ISO 180/A kJ/m² 12
    Izod Notched Impact Strength, -30 °C ISO 180/A kJ/m² 6
    Tensile Modulus ISO 527 MPa 3100
    Tensile Stress at Yield, 23 °C ISO 527 MPa 55
    Tensile Strain at Yield, 23 °C ISO 527 % 3
    Tensile Stress at Break, 23 °C ISO 527 MPa 50
    Tensile Strain at Break, 23 °C ISO 527 % 7
    Nominal Strain at Break, 23 °C ISO 527 % 6
    Tensile Modulus after Moisture Absorption, Equilibrium 23 °C/50% RH ISO 527 MPa 2400
    Tensile Stress at Yield after Moisture Absorption, Equilibrium 23 °C/50% RH ISO 527 MPa 40
    Tensile Strain at Yield after Moisture Absorption, Equilibrium 23 °C/50% RH ISO 527 % 4
    Nominal Strain at Break after Moisture Absorption, Equilibrium 23 °C/50% RH ISO 527 % 12
    Flexural Modulus, 23 °C ISO 178 MPa 2800
    Flexural Strength, 23 °C ISO 178 MPa 85
    Hardness, Ball Indentation ISO 2039-1 MPa 99
    Thermal Properties
    Vicat Softening Temperature VST/B/50 (50N, 50 °C/h) ISO 306 °C 118
    Heat Deflection Temperature A; (annealed 4 h/80 °C; 1.8 MPa) ISO 75 °C 97
    Heat Deflection Temperature B; (annealed 4 h/80 °C; 0.45 MPa) ISO 75 °C 171
    Coefficient of Linear Thermal Expansion ISO 11359 10-6/°C 60
    Other Properties
    Density ISO 1183 kg/m³ 1120
    Glass Fibre content - % 8
    UL94 rating at 1.5 mm thickness IEC 60695-11-10 - HB
    Glow wire test (GWFI), 2.0 mm IEC 60695-2-12 °C 650
    Moisture Absorption, Equilibrium 23 °C/50% RH ISO 62 % 1,1
    Processing
    Melt Temperature Range ISO 294 °C 240 - 270
    Mold Temperature Range ISO 294 °C 60 - 80
    Drying Temperature - °C 80 - 90
    Drying Time - h 4 - 8
    Linear Mold Shrinkage ISO 294-4 % 0,5 - 0,8

    Typical values for uncolored products
